This indulgent twist on a classic sausage casserole is pure comfort in a dish. The sausages, smoky bacon lardons, and earthy chestnut mushrooms are simmered in a rich red wine and beef stock sauce, with a touch of redcurrant jelly for sweetness. Topped with creamy Parmesan mash and finished under the grill until golden and bubbling, it’s a hearty, flavour-packed bake that’s perfect for cosy nights in. Serve with seasonal vegetables for a complete family favourite meal. …

This Shredded Beef Stew Cottage Pie with Caramelised Vegetables is the ultimate cold-weather comfort dish. Slow-cooked beef is braised in Guinness with garlic, herbs and root veg until it falls apart, then folded with sweet caramelised onions and carrots for incredible depth and richness. Topped with buttery mashed potato and a layer of mature cheddar, it’s baked until golden, bubbling and irresistibly crisp. A hearty, flavour-packed cottage pie that’s perfect for cosy evenings or a satisfying family dinner.
